Gilder Lehrman Collection #: GLC09573.01.18 Author/Creator: Wetmore, Nellie Joe (fl. 1963) Place Written: Rome, Italy Type: Autograph letter signed Date: July 1963 Pagination: 2 p. ; 22 x 17.3 cm. Order a Copy

Nellie is writing to Davis on a telegraph sent to her in Rome from Rod. The telegraph confirms for Nellie that Rod is "in for transfer," which means they can visit. She is very happy about this news. The weather has been raining since she arrived. Nellie writes she sent a few packages back to friends from Greece and has bought Christmas presents. She gives condolences about Myrtle dying.
